I've been experimenting with arrays with hud messages.
i've created the hud messages:
Code:
#define MAXMESSAGES 4
new Messages[MAXMESSAGES] = {
"Hello",
"Welcome",
"Test1",
"Test2";
}
and i created a code for the text msgs:
Code:
public e_r_hud(id) { // e_r_hud is a ResetHUD event
new m_id = 1; 0 > m_id; m_id++ // this is supposed to change the message
set_hudmessage(200,100,0,-1.0,0.35,0,6.0,12.0)
show_hudmessage(id,"%s",Messages[m_id])
}
i get these errors when i compile:
Code:
error 001: expected token: "}", but found ";"
warning 215: expression has no effect
here is the hole script:
Code:
/* Plugin generated by AMXX-Studio */
#include <amxmodx>
#include <amxmisc>
#define PLUGIN "New Plugin"
#define VERSION "0.1"
#define AUTHOR "Meta"
#define MAXMESSAGES 4
new Messages[MAXMESSAGES] = {
"Hello",
"Welcome",
"Test1",
"Test2";
}
public plugin_init() {
register_plugin(PLUGIN, VERSION, AUTHOR)
register_event("ResetHUD","e_r_hud","b")
}
public e_r_hud(id) {
new m_id = 1; 0 > m_id; m_id++
set_hudmessage(200,100,0,-1.0,0.35,0,6.0,12.0)
show_hudmessage(id,"%s",Messages[m_id])
}
__________________